Welcome to 107 Dixon Court, a move-in ready family home tucked away on a quiet cul-de-sac in Timberlea. It offers a great location, comfort, and energy efficiency with solar panels and a ductless heat pump on every level. A double paved driveway and welcoming verandah create a warm first impression, and a perfect spot to sip your morning coffee. Inside, the spacious foyer opens to the living room, featuring a bay window, hardwood flooring, and a ductless heat pump. French doors lead into the dining room, which flows seamlessly to a private, full-width deck. The show-stopping kitchen is sure to be the heart of the home, offering quartz countertops, stainless steel appliances, an island with extra storage, vinyl plank flooring, and an abundance of cupboard space. A convenient 2-piece bath completes the main level. Upstairs, you’ll find three bedrooms including the primary bedroom featuring a walk-in closet, a ductless heat pump, and access to the cheater-style main bath offering a relaxing whirlpool tub and separate stand-up shower. The fully finished walkout basement adds even more space for the family, hosting guests or movie nights. It includes a cozy rec room with a ductless heat pump and custom shelving, a fourth bedroom, a full bath, and a laundry room. This home is just steps from excellent schools and within walking distance to the BLT Trail and Bluff Wilderness area, while golf lovers can enjoy a quick round at Brunello. All amenities are close at hand with Bayer's Lake just minutes away, and downtown Halifax only a short 30-minute drive.
